The Stridewell chip readers at the Kelmsford course stopped posting split times at 06:12 because the gateway's credential for the internal Lapline ingest service expired overnight. The reader firmware itself is fine; it buffered reads locally, so no splits were lost. I've regenerated the credential with the same read-write scope and verified ingestion resumes in staging. Reviewer: please confirm the retry/backoff change in gateway.go doesn't mask future auth failures. The replacement key for the ingest service is below.

API key for tagef-fafop: vxb2-ta

## Ticket: Config drift in Ledgerline ORM refactor

While refactoring the legacy ORM layer in Ledgerline, we found that staging and production have quietly diverged — staging still has verbose query logging on (including bound parameters, yikes), and the connection encryption flag differs between the two. The refactor branch assumes a single canonical config, so we need to reconcile before merge. Flagging for security review since the logging gap could have leaked query data. For reference, here's what production is actually running with.

settings of tagef-bawif:
DRUIX_HOST=druix.zemvarlabs.internal
DRUIX_PORT=8000

Build provenance — Gustline weather-alert fan-out. All production images are built by the Hollowmere pipeline from signed commits; no manual pushes are permitted. Each artifact carries an attestation linking source revision, builder identity, and dependency lockfile digest. Reviewers should verify the attestation chain before approving promotion to the alerting tier, since a tampered fan-out binary could suppress severe-weather notifications. The attestation for the current release candidate resolves to the token recorded below.

build token for tawip-yageg: htk9_92ac43d42

Vendor note: Brightlark Systems ships the dark-mode theme pack for the Quillview admin dashboard. Their toggle overrides our CSS variables, so any palette regression after a vendor release is likely theirs, not ours. Verify contrast on the billing tables before escalating. For theme-related incidents, reach the Brightlark support desk here.

escalation mailbox, bafog-fafog: ulador@paliqlabs.internal